After soaring to four goals the game before, Berea was a bit more limited in their match on Monday.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Greer Yellow Jackets.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against Greer this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 3-0 back in March.
Berea's loss dropped their record down to 6-8. As for Greer,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 8-4.
Berea has already played their next contest, a 4-3 defeat against Seneca on the 22nd. As for Greer, they also didn't take long to hit the pitch again: they've already played their next game, a 1-0 victory against Blue Ridge on the 22nd.
